by Mushroom
I heard that he made the request back in March but it’s just being reported on now.

I’m not a Lamar Jackson believer at all. He’s been propped up on such a high pedestal as if he’s actually done something. (I couldn’t care less about the QB popularity contest he won in 2019 either - aka “mOsT VaLuAbLe PlAyEr” - what a joke that award has become 🤮) I just see him as a glorified running back with a good arm. Teams know he’s too much of a liability to give him the contract he’s asking for. That’s why running backs are a dime a dozen these days and so rapidly replaced. They play a tough position and are too prone to injury. To have your quarter of a billion dollar quarterback playing the role of a 1 million dollar running back is not something any team owner is ever going to do. (At least not without being forced to sell the team afterwards for such incompetence)

When Deshaun was actually playing (before his suspension) I personally thought he was rivaling Mahomes, but he was just trapped on the Texans. Deshaun seemed more athletic and like he had better poise under pressure. He didn’t rely on scrambling out of the pocket so much but he was plenty capable if needed. Without the suspension, I believe he could’ve elevated himself to being, at least, one of the top 3 QB’s in the league. I personally don’t believe any player should be worth the contract he got from the Browns but I do think he could’ve truly earned and been worth one of the highest paying contracts in the league had he not been suspended.

As it looks right now, the Browns gambled and lost big time! Watson was so far from the player he used to be. It could’ve been a result of not playing for so long but regardless he still wasnt anywhere near good enough to justify his contract. The Browns are now a stand-out example of how not to pay your QB. No other owner wants to be seen as the next Jimmy Haslam. If Lamar gets the contract he wants, that team owner has great potential to be the next Jimmy Haslam.
